4.1 Enhanced Durability and Longevity
Groove hot-dip galvanized cable trays are designed to withstand harsh environmental conditions. The galvanization process involves coating the steel with a layer of zinc, which acts as a barrier against corrosion and wear. This durability ensures that the trays maintain their structural integrity over time, even in challenging industrial settings.
4.2 Corrosion Resistance and Maintenance
The hot-dip galvanization process not only enhances durability but also provides excellent corrosion resistance. This is particularly beneficial in environments where moisture or chemicals are present. Reduced corrosion leads to lower maintenance costs and a longer lifespan for the trays, contributing to overall safety and functionality.

6. Installation Best Practices for Safety
Proper installation is crucial to maximizing the safety benefits of groove hot-dip galvanized cable trays. Here are some best practices:
1. **Assess the Environment**: Understand the specific requirements of your workspace, including load capacity and exposure to corrosive elements.
2. **Follow Manufacturer Guidelines**: Always adhere to the installation instructions provided by the manufacturer to ensure safe and effective use.
3. **Regular Inspections**: Conduct periodic inspections of cable trays to identify any signs of wear or damage that could compromise safety.
4. **Train Employees**: Provide training for staff on the importance of proper cable management and how to maintain the trays to ensure ongoing safety.

8. Frequently Asked Questions
What are groove hot-dip galvanized cable trays?
Groove hot-dip galvanized cable trays are metal trays used to support and organize electrical wiring, protected by a layer of zinc for durability and corrosion resistance.
How do groove hot-dip galvanized cable trays improve workplace safety?
These trays help organize cables, reducing trip hazards and the risk of electrical accidents, while also complying with safety regulations.
What environmental factors can affect the performance of cable trays?
Moisture, chemicals, and temperature variations can impact the integrity of cable trays. However, hot-dip galvanized trays are designed to withstand these factors.
How often should cable trays be inspected for safety?
Regular inspections should occur at least bi-annually, with more frequent checks in high-traffic or hazardous areas.
Can groove hot-dip galvanized cable trays be used outdoors?
Yes, they are suitable for outdoor use due to their corrosion-resistant properties, making them ideal for various industrial applications.
